Issue:
Electrical: After changing the wd.env file to a new custom wd.env location paths stay the same.
Causes:
Default wd.env file
Solution:
You must rename the default wd.env file.
Then restart Electrical.
Example:
You have a custom wd.env file located on your network. You would like to use this wd.env file.
When you select this file, it opens however the paths stay the same.
- After you select the new wd.env file from the new location.
- Go to C:\Users\<username>\Documents\Acade 20xx\AeData
- Rename the existing wd.env file to something like xxxwd.env (always keep the original in case you need to go back).
- Restart Autodesk Electrical.
The paths should now match the custom wd.env file from the new location.
